Arrowstreet Capital, L.P. provides global and international investment strategies to institutional investors. Specific products include Global Equities, International Equities, Global Small Cap Equities, International Small Cap Equities, Emerging Market Equities, and Global Long/Short Equities. History and Organization
Arrowstreet was founded in and registered with the Securities and Exchange Commission in July 1999. The firm's three founding partners are Bruce Clarke, Peter Rathjens and John Campbell. Bruce and Peter serve as President and CIO, respectively, while John splits his time between his role as Co-Director of Research and as the Morton L. and Carole S. Olshan Professor of Economics at Harvard University.

Arrowstreet is structured as a limited partnership that is wholly owned and controlled by its senior professionals.

By keeping ownership and control in the hands of management, Arrowstreet is able to align the firm’s interests with those of its clients, and attract and retain a talented group of investment professionals – the core of whom have worked together for over a decade. These individuals all have outstanding academic and professional qualifications.

Competitive Advantages
Processing of Information: Arrowstreet’s proprietary forecasting process allows the firm to 1) simultaneously consider a variety of behavioral and informational relationships on a direct as well as on an indirect basis in order to improve forecasts and 2) leverage insights across thousands of stocks to uncover a broad range of opportunities.

Independent and Employee Owned: Arrowstreet’s ownership structure allows the firm to align its interests with those of its clients and to attract, motivate, and retain a talented group of investment professionals.

Focused Product Set: Specialization allows Arrowstreet to maintain its expertise and quickly implement its best ideas.

Key Client Benefits
Consistency: Arrowstreet’s innovative multi-dimensional approach seeks to outperform during a broad range of market environments.

Dynamic Risk Control: Arrowstreet manages the risk profile of its portfolios according to changing market conditions in an attempt to minimize the likelihood of negative surprises.

Complementary Approach: Arrowstreet’s unique process and lack of systematic tilts tends to diversify other managers.

Non-Investment Alpha: Arrowstreet shares research insights into a variety of investment topics that are of value to institutional investors. Specific examples of this range from working with pension funds that oversee internally managed investment portfolios to helping staff with long-term strategic asset allocation issues.
